About the Course
Policymaking plays a key role in the management and change of the economy and society. From policy conceptualisation, implementation and management to evaluation and research, there are few professional areas where you can impact society as much as when you are helping to shape public policy.The Master of Public Policy and Governance provides specialist studies in public policy and management, public administration and public governance of services at local, national and international levels. This degree applies a social science perspective to questions of policy and management in modern organisations. The courses are taught by policymakers or policy researchers who bring their real-life experience to the classroom, revealing the relationship between theory, research and everyday practice.
